Essential Elements of a Focused Desk Setup

1. Choose the Right Desk and Chair

Desk height: Your desk should allow your elbows to rest comfortably at a 90-degree angle when typing.

Chair support: Opt for an adjustable chair with good lumbar support to maintain proper posture.

Foot position: Feet should rest flat on the floor or on a footrest to avoid pressure under the thighs.

2. Position Your Monitor Correctly

– Place the monitor about an arm’s length away.

– The top of the screen should be at or slightly below eye level to reduce neck strain.

– Avoid glare by positioning the screen perpendicular to windows or using adjustable blinds.

Comfort Tips to Improve Your Desk Setup

1. Use Ergonomic Accessories

Keyboard and mouse: Choose ergonomic designs to reduce wrist strain.

Wrist rests: Soft pads can provide extra comfort during long typing sessions.

Monitor stands or arms: Adjustable stands help customize monitor height.

2. Incorporate Personal Comfort Items

– A small desk fan or heater can help regulate your temperature.

– Soft lighting options reduce eye strain compared to harsh overhead lights.

– Add a cushion or lumbar roll for extra chair support.

Additional Tips for a Healthy Desk Setup

Take Regular Breaks

– Follow the 20-20-20 rule: every 20 minutes, look at something 20 feet away for 20 seconds.

– Stand, stretch, or walk every hour to improve circulation and reduce stiffness.

Maintain Good Posture

– Sit back fully in your chair and keep your back straight.

– Avoid crossing your legs to maintain good circulation.

– Adjust your setup if you notice discomfort throughout the day.
